International Interlaboratory Scientific Study for Standardization of Next-Generation Sequencing in Food Authenticity Testing
Government and Industry-Leading Organizations are Among the Laboratories Signed Up to Test the Accuracy and Consistency of Thermo Fisher Scientific's NGS Authenticity Workflow.
Thermo Fisher Scientific is working with governmental, industry, and contract testing laboratories to create a standard dataset that will accelerate the use of next-generation sequencing (NGS) in food authenticity, by giving analyzers the ability to test with confidence.
The pioneering NGS method, which detects multi-species DNA in food and ingredient samples, has the potential to tackle food fraud—a global problem that puts lives at risk, decimates reputations, and costs the industry an estimated $10-$40 billion in losses each year.
